In this powerful episode, MamaBeast Dr. Lulu and Chelsea Page Moses talk with Ellen Craig, a dedicated advocate for the LGBTQ+ community and a proud parent of a transgender child. The conversation delves into the challenges faced by transgender individuals, the importance of self-affirmation, and the need to educate oneself on gender identity issues. Ellen shares her personal journey of supporting her child's identity and highlights the significance of treating everyone as human beings. Ellen passionately addresses the societal stigma and lack of understanding surrounding transgender individuals within the BIPOC community. Through candid discussions, she emphasizes the need for empathy, education, and acceptance to create a safe and inclusive environment for all individuals, regardless of their gender identity. Key Takeaways: Importance of on-going education and unlearning societal biases about transgender individuals. Emphasis on treating all individuals, including transgender people, with kindness and respect. The significance of self-affirmation and supporting loved ones on their journey to self-discovery. Addressing the fear of safety and societal judgment faced by many transgender individuals and their families. Encouragement to embrace personal growth, self-discovery, and continuous support for marginalized communities. K. Chesterton (1874 - 1936) LibriVox LibriVox volunteers bring you 9 recordings of The Song Against Songs by G. K. Chesterton. This was the Fortnightly Poetry project for October 16, 2011.Chesterton was a large man, standing 6 feet 4 inches (1.93 m) and weighing around 21 stone (130 kg; 290 lb). His girth gave rise to a famous anecdote. During World War I a lady in London asked why he was not 'out at the Front'; he replied, 'If you go round to the side, you will see that I am.' On another occasion he remarked to his friend George Bernard Shaw: "To look at you, anyone would think a famine had struck England". Shaw retorted, "To look at you, anyone would think you have caused it". P. G.
